Saudi Arabia Sets Guinness World Record with World’s Largest Digital Solutions Hackathon

Saudi Arabia has created history by setting a Guinness World Record for hosting the largest digital solutions hackathon, reinforcing the Kingdom’s growing reputation as a global hub for innovation, technology, and digital transformation. The record-breaking event brought together thousands of participants, including developers, engineers, designers, entrepreneurs, and students, all collaborating to solve real-world challenges through technology.

The massive hackathon focused on digital solutions across multiple sectors, including artificial intelligence, smart cities, fintech, healthcare technology, cybersecurity, sustainability, and e-governance. Teams worked intensively over a limited time period to develop innovative prototypes, applications, and platforms aimed at addressing both local and global challenges.

According to event organizers, the scale of participation and the number of active contributors officially qualified the hackathon for Guinness World Records recognition, making it the largest event of its kind ever conducted. Independent adjudicators verified participant numbers, engagement criteria, and compliance with Guinness guidelines before confirming the record.

Saudi officials described the achievement as a milestone aligned with Vision 2030, the Kingdom’s long-term strategy to diversify its economy beyond oil and invest heavily in technology, digital skills, and knowledge-based industries. By encouraging large-scale collaboration and creativity, the hackathon aimed to nurture homegrown talent while also attracting international innovators.

Participants benefited from mentorship sessions led by industry experts, workshops on emerging technologies, and access to advanced digital tools and platforms. Winning teams received funding opportunities, incubation support, and pathways to further develop their ideas into scalable solutions with real-world impact.

Technology leaders and observers praised the event for demonstrating how large nations can mobilize youth and professionals at scale to drive innovation. Many noted that beyond the world record, the hackathon’s true success lay in the ideas generated, partnerships formed, and skills developed during the event.

The Guinness World Record has further positioned Saudi Arabia as a leader in large-scale digital innovation initiatives, signaling its ambition to compete on the global technology stage. Organizers confirmed that similar and even larger innovation-driven events are planned in the coming years.
